Fearlessness is the first requisite of spirituality. Cowards can never be moral. ~ Mahatma Gandhi Just as courage imperils life, fear protects it. ~ Leonardo Da Vinci All my fears and cares are of this world; if there is another, an honest man has nothing to fear from it. ~ Robert Burns An utterly fearless man is a far more dangerous comrade than a coward. ~ Herman Melville The fear is worse than the pain. ~ Shannon Bahr There were all kinds of things of which I was afraid at first, ranging from grizzly bears to “mean” horses and gun-fighters; but by acting as if I was not afraid I gradually ceased to be afraid. ~ Theodore Roosevelt There are two reasons why people fail. One is irresponsibility. The second is fear. ~ Wally Amos Fear was absolutely necessary. Without it, I would have been scared to death. ~ Floyd Patterson
"Whatever fortune brings, don't be afraid of doing things." ~ A. A. Milne
